Memory treatment tasks assist homeowners be more involved, encourage their self-reliance, and increase their self-confidence. Stage-appropriate activities are essential for keeping homeowners engaged while staying clear of aggravation. For example, a citizen in the beginning of Alzheimer's might delight in an extra challenging 500-piece jigsaw challenge, while a local in the later phases might need a challenge with less, bigger items. Also after knowing the advantages of memory take care of senior parents, making this decision can be a hard one. Lots of people are typically torn in between the advantages of memory care versus treatment in your home. It's additionally easy to presume that home treatment is
much more cost effective. This isn't always the situation. Hiring a home care agency can be costly, and having your liked one in your home can pose even more risks as mental deterioration advances. They may attempt to drive or prepare and inadvertently leave the oven on if they're not frequently checked. Both memory care and in-home care can be extremely efficient solutions for the security risks that go along with cognitive decrease. Those that pick a memory treatment center understand the following benefits contrasted to those that select in-home treatment: Memory treatment facilities have to fulfill stringent guidelines in all facets of care including nourishment, safety and security, monitoring of medical problems, sanitation, staffing levels, and are checked regularly Memory treatment communities are designed with resident security in mind, which indicates slip-resistant floor covering, handrails, bigger bathrooms and bedrooms, and the elimination of safety risks (like stoves). Aided living refers to living neighborhoods and healthcare for those who need aid with day-to-day care. The difference between assisted living and other treatment exists in just how much help is needed. Assisted living facilities often tend to supply homeowners with more freedom. Assisted living facilities provide aid for individuals that desire flexibility to live yet that require small assist with day-to-day activities.
